Swatches of four Shiro eyeshadows

Just a few more samples I've collected from Shiro Cosmetics! Each baggie holds SO much product - I always transfer them to jars and they almost fill 3g jars.
Samples from Shiro Cosmetics, L-R: Detective, More Sugar
I heard about Detective (from the Death Note collection) and was super excited. Taupe with blue duochrome? Must have! But I wanted to wait until I had seen swatches, and the blog posts I saw had very different opinions on whether or not Detective is a true duochrome. So finally I just ordered the sample ($1, instead of a $3 mini or $5 full jar).
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Detective, More Sugar; direct sunlight, no flash
Well, Detective is and isn't a duochrome. It's very subtle, with scattered color-changing particles. The base color is a golden taupe and with the pale blue and silver sheen, it comes off pretty cool-toned. I do like it, for sure, but it's not as dramatic as I had hoped the color shift would be.
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Detective, More Sugar; direct sunlight, no flash
The camera picks up the blue sparkles as glitter, not so much as a duochrome. But in natural lighting in person, you can see a bit of a color shift.
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Detective, More Sugar; direct sunlight, no flash
More Sugar, also from the Death Note collection, is described as "creamy shimmer in a rich coffee base." This is a beautiful plummy taupe with multi-colored shimmer and a satin finish. It was actually my free sample, and I'm really pleased with it!
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Detective, More Sugar; direct sunlight, no flash
You can just see a bit of the red, green, and blue glitter in More Sugar - it's not too over-the-top, it's more toned down glitter.

Then, I ordered some samples for an upcoming giveaway, and received Articuno and Mewtwo samples free (both from the Super Effective collection).
Samples from Shiro Cosmetics, L-R: Articuno, More Sugar
These are not the most exciting Shiro colors (to me anyway), but they are the same fantastic quality I've come to expect from Shiro.
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Articuno, Mewtwo; direct sunlight, no flash
Articuno is described as "pale, powdery silver-blue with plenty of shimmer and sparkle." That is a really accurate description IMO!
Swatches over Pixie Epoxy, L-R: Articuno, Mewtwo; direct sunlight, no flash
Mewtwo's description is "sheer, shimmery, medium purple with blue tones." I'm not sure I'd really call it sheer ... maybe over bare skin, but then most mineral shadows are sheer on bare skin! It is a cool-toned darkish purple with some multi-colred shimmer.
